The NIS Directive: Foundations and Impact on Cybersecurity Standards

The NIS Directive, adopted in 2016, is the EU’s first legislation aimed at strengthening cybersecurity across member states. It establishes essential security requirements for critical infrastructure operators and digital service providers. The directive emphasizes a network and information system security approach to reduce cyber risks.

By harmonizing cybersecurity standards and reporting obligations, the NIS Directive significantly enhances cooperation among EU countries. It requires national authorities to designate CSIRTs (Computer Security Incident Response Teams) responsible for incident response and information sharing. This framework promotes a unified response to cyber threats, elevating overall cybersecurity resilience across the EU.

The NIS Directive’s impact on cybersecurity standards lies in its mandatory security measures and incident reports. It sets a baseline for cybersecurity practices, influencing the development of national policies. The directive has laid the foundation for more comprehensive regulations, such as the subsequent NIS2 Directive, to address evolving cyber risks and improve enforcement mechanisms.

The Cybersecurity Act: Establishing the EU Agency for Cybersecurity

The Cybersecurity Act established the EU Agency for Cybersecurity, known as ENISA, with the objective of enhancing cybersecurity resilience across the European Union. The act formalizes ENISA’s role in supporting member states and institutions.

ENISA’s mandate encompasses cybersecurity policy development, capacity building, and raising awareness among stakeholders. The agency provides technical expertise, guidance, and assistance to facilitate the implementation of EU cybersecurity measures.

One significant function of ENISA under the Cybersecurity Act is developing certification schemes for ICT products and services. These schemes aim to ensure the security and trustworthiness of digital solutions utilized within the EU market.

The act empowers ENISA to coordinate efforts among member states, improve information sharing, and respond effectively to cyber threats. It thus plays a pivotal role in strengthening the EU’s unified approach to cybersecurity regulation and enforcement.

General Data Protection Regulation (GDPR) and Its Cybersecurity Implications

The General Data Protection Regulation (GDPR) has significant cybersecurity implications within the European Union legal framework. It emphasizes the importance of protecting personal data and requires organizations to implement appropriate security measures.

GDPR mandates that data controllers and processors adopt technical and organizational safeguards, such as encryption and access controls, to prevent data breaches. Non-compliance can result in hefty fines and reputational damage.

Key cybersecurity responsibilities under GDPR include:

  1. Conducting regular risk assessments
  2. Notifying authorities of data breaches within 72 hours
  3. Maintaining detailed records of processing activities
  4. Implementing privacy-by-design and default principles

These provisions directly influence how businesses handle sensitive information and bolster the overall cybersecurity posture across EU member states. GDPR’s cybersecurity measures form a foundational element of the broader EU cybersecurity regulations landscape, aligning data protection with proactive security strategies.

Challenges in Implementing EU Cybersecurity Regulations

Implementing EU cybersecurity regulations presents several notable challenges for organizations across member states. One primary difficulty is the variability in technological maturity among organizations, which affects their ability to meet uniform compliance standards. Smaller enterprises often lack the resources and expertise necessary for effective cybersecurity measures.

Another challenge involves the complexity of the regulatory framework itself. The evolving nature of EU cybersecurity laws requires organizations to continuously adapt, which can lead to compliance gaps or delays. Staying updated with amendments and new directives demands significant effort.

Additionally, differences in national implementation approaches may result in inconsistent enforcement. Variations in how authorities interpret and apply regulations can create legal uncertainties, complicating cross-border compliance efforts within the EU.

Finally, organizations often face difficulties in managing cybersecurity risks without disrupting ongoing operations. Balancing security investments while maintaining business continuity remains a persistent challenge, especially given the rapid pace of technological change and growing cyber threats.
